3D modeling, texturing, and effects
Create and animate geometry in several intuitive ways with new and enhanced spline tools.
Create OSL maps in the material editor from simple math nodes to procedural textures.
Morph visible seams by simplifying the process of blending projected texture maps.
Create best-in-class procedural modeling details that handles some of the most difficult tasks with ease.
Manipulate hair and fur directly in viewports with selection and styling tools, such as tools for cutting and brushing.
Leverage vertex, edge, and face information to procedurally modify your models.
Create parametric Boolean operations on two or more splines with the familiar UI from 3D Booleans.
Efficiently create parametric and organic objects with polygon, subdivision surface, and spline-based modeling features.
3D animation and dynamics
Create realistic liquid behaviors directly in 3ds Max. (video: 12 sec.)
Manipulate animations directly in the viewport and get direct feedback when making adjustments in your scene.
Create procedural animation and character rigging with CAT, biped, and crowd animation tools.
Use keyframe and procedural animation tools. View and edit animation trajectories directly in the viewport.
Author animation controllers, using a new generation of animation tools that you can create, modify, package, and share.
Create sophisticated particle effects such as water, fire, spray, and snow.
Animate simulation data in CFD, CSV, or OpenVDB formats.
Quickly and easily generate better skin weighting.
3D rendering
As part of our OSL integration, you can display procedural maps created with OSL at 1:1 quality using Nitrous viewport.
The MAXtoA plug-in is integrated into 3ds Max, giving you access to Arnold’s latest features.
Simulate real-life camera settings such as shutter speed, aperture, depth of field, exposure, and other options.
Directly manipulate your scene content in your final ActiveShade render.
Create accurate images of architectural scenes.
Edit scenes directly from within VR in 3ds Max Interactive, and see updates pushed back to 3ds Max in real time.
UI, workflow, and pipeline
Leverage the power of 3ds Max for automation by using 3ds Max as a true command-line tool.
Gain tighter integration with several pipeline tools with an extended and improved Python/.NET toolset.
The included Alembic inport inspector allows to you check a file before importing. With support for Alembic 1.7 instancing.
Create your own custom workspaces with a more modern, responsive, high-DPI-ready user interface.
Seamlessly move from one renderer to another.
Vehicles created in CivilView now support the 3ds Max physical material, reducing conversion and simplifying rendering.
Share models and review feedback online with the Autodesk Viewer directly from the 3ds Max interface.
Create new projects with greater folder structure flexibility, smarter project switching, and store custom data.
